How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Shakercrest?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Shakercrest Studio Apartments | $1,406 | $1,299 | $1,899 |
| Shakercrest 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,681 | $950 | $3,000 |
Shakercrest 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,969 | $1,206 | $5,934 |
| Shakercrest 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,283 | $1,571 | $7,815 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Shakercrest Apartments
What is a cheap apartment in Shakercrest?
A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Shakercrest is under $1,424.
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Shakercrest?
The cheapest apartment in Shakercrest is Executive Club which is listed at $1,110, while the average apartment in Shakercrest costs $3,070.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Shakercrest?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 13 regular apartments in Shakercrest that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
